Experiments to Determine the Thermal-Mechanical Response when Molten Zircaloy-4 Flows onto a Ballooned Pressure Tube

Abstract
An experimental program has been set up to investigate the thermal-mechanical behaviour of a fuel channel when molten Zircaloy-4 (Zr-4) from a fuel bundle flows onto a ballooned pressure tube. The first two tests of the series were carried out with a pressure of 3 MPa inside the pressure tube and subcooling on the calandria tube of about 20 degrees C. Results show that the calandria tube dries out directly under the Zr-4 melt but quickly rewets within 22 s. The maximum calandria tube temperature measured directly under the molten Zr-4 droplet was 900 degrees C. This paper describes the experimental setup and summarizes results from these first two tests.
